原创 2011-2016 第二個5年計劃(如果2012不是世界末日)
剛畢業的時候目標明確的很,但是經過了這幾年發現現實還是和夢想有距離的。值得慶幸的是至少畢業制定的5年的計劃提前到了3年半就完成的。也正是完成了,加上現實的種種,反而對自己的以後的路有些難決定了。至少現在拖了半年的時間,硬是沒有想清楚下面
原创 Linux下的SVN使用---命令行控的最愛
1、Linux命令行下將文件checkout到本地目錄 svn checkout path(path是服務器上的目錄) svn checkout 2、Linux命令行下往版本庫中添加新的文件 svn add f
原创 引導加載程序之爭:瞭解 LILO 和 GRUB
引導加載程序之爭:瞭解 LILO 和 GRUB 對照並比較這兩個競爭對手 級 別: 初級 Laurence Bonney ([email protected] ), WebSphere MQ JMS Test
原创 【Andorid】input系統的事件處理
在上篇中有一個基本的input的設備的簡介,這裏我們在說一下input core相關的東東。 先來個開胃菜,先看看struct input_devstruct input_dev { const char *name;
原创 【doc/input】input系統基礎
在我的印象中,input系統應該是將輸入設備進行了抽象得到的一個統一的接口。常見的鍵盤,光鼠,軌跡球,傳感器我們都可以歸到input系統中來。 編寫一個input的基本的步驟是: 1創建input device和driver 1.0
原创 Shell中if的相關參數
由於自己不是經常使用shell,所以有時候命令經常容易忘,這裏把其中的一個if的參數給保存下吧。 -----------------------------華麗的分割線之下是轉貼內容-------------------------
原创 Android Sensor 適配層的書寫--主要是對函數的介紹
Sensor 適配層的書寫-----大家多討論 前文說了,適配層的基本的接口。現在將接口中的內容擴展說下,其實在sensors.h文件中已經說的很明確了,這裏只不過是怕自己有遺忘翻譯了一下。 /** * Every device da
原创 bus,device,driver三者關係
bus,device,driver三者關係 bus: 總線作爲主機和外設的連接通道,有些總線是比較規範的,形成了很多協議。如 PCI,USB,1394,IIC等。任何設備都可以選擇合適的總線連接到主機。當然主機也可能就是CPU本身。內存也
原创 Android的傳感器HAL層的書寫---基礎篇
關於傳感器,大家在日常的生活中用的很多。比如樓宇的樓梯燈,馬路上的路燈等等。那麼我們手機裏的傳感器又可以起到哪些作用呢?現在看下我們的Android中給提供了哪些吧。有加速度傳感器,磁場,方向,陀螺儀,光線,壓力,溫度,接近傳感器。
原创 mstsc保存用戶名和密碼,實現自動登錄遠程桌面
mstsc保存用戶名和密碼,實現自動登錄遠程桌面 首先可以使用mstsc /?來查看關於mstsc的參數說明 根據上述的命令說明,我這裏實現的bat文件爲 mstsc C:/a.rdp /console /v:
原创 Android編譯錯誤處理
1、java.util.zip.ZipException: duplicate entry: hyts_Foo.c 錯誤 java.util.zip.ZipException: duplicate entry: hyts_Fo
原创 使用 inotify 監控文件系統的活動
系統管理就像日常生活一樣。就像刷牙和吃蔬菜一樣,日常的維護能保持機器的良好狀態。您必須定期清空廢物,比如臨時文件或無用的日誌文件,以及花時間填寫表單、回覆電話、下載更新和監控進程等。幸好自動化 shell 腳本、使用 Nagios
原创 Android Lights筆記
Android Lights 1、lights類型 在Android中目前定義的lights有以下的幾種。 /* * These light IDs correspond to logical lights, not physi
原创 arm Linux系統啓動之----reset_init,系統1號進程
先來看下一些基礎概念內核線程(thread)或叫守護進程(daemon),在操作系統中佔據相當大的比例,當Linux操作系統啓動以後,尤其是Xwindow也啓動以後,你可以用”ps”命令查看系統中的進程,這時會發現很多以”d”結尾的進程名
原创 arm Linux系統啓動之----start_kernel函數
head-common.S ---具體做了哪些動作 ---跳轉到init/main.c ---b start_kernel //關於start_kernel的強文深入理解linux內核,第八章 main.c asmlinkage v